O que é renovação?
A renovação é um conceito que se refere ao processo de atualização, modificação ou substituição de algo que já existe. No contexto da Inteligência Artificial (IA) e Machine Learning (ML), a renovação pode se aplicar a modelos, algoritmos e dados. A necessidade de renovação surge da evolução constante das tecnologias e das mudanças nas demandas do mercado, que exigem que os sistemas se adaptem para permanecerem relevantes e eficazes.
Importância da renovação em IA e ML
A renovação é crucial em IA e ML, pois os modelos precisam ser constantemente ajustados para lidar com novas informações e padrões. À medida que mais dados são coletados, a capacidade de um modelo de prever ou classificar corretamente pode diminuir se não houver uma renovação adequada. Isso garante que os sistemas permaneçam precisos e úteis, evitando o fenômeno conhecido como “overfitting”, onde um modelo se torna excessivamente ajustado a um conjunto de dados específico.
Como ocorre a renovação de modelos
A renovação de modelos em IA e ML pode ocorrer de várias maneiras. Uma abordagem comum é o re-treinamento, onde um modelo existente é atualizado com novos dados. Isso pode incluir a adição de novos exemplos ao conjunto de treinamento ou a modificação dos parâmetros do modelo para melhorar seu desempenho. Além disso, novas arquiteturas de redes neurais podem ser implementadas para aproveitar avanços recentes na pesquisa.
Renovação de dados
A renovação de dados é um aspecto fundamental do processo de renovação em IA e ML. À medida que o ambiente muda, os dados que foram inicialmente coletados podem se tornar obsoletos ou irrelevantes. Portanto, é essencial atualizar os conjuntos de dados regularmente para garantir que os modelos sejam treinados com informações atuais e representativas. Isso pode incluir a coleta de novos dados, a remoção de dados desatualizados e a verificação da qualidade dos dados existentes.
Desafios da renovação
Embora a renovação seja vital, ela também apresenta desafios significativos. Um dos principais desafios é o custo associado ao re-treinamento de modelos e à atualização de dados. Além disso, a integração de novos dados pode ser complexa, especialmente se os dados antigos e novos não forem compatíveis. Outro desafio é garantir que a renovação não introduza viés ou erros nos modelos, o que pode comprometer a precisão das previsões.
Técnicas de renovação
Dentre as técnicas de renovação, o aprendizado contínuo se destaca. Essa abordagem permite que os modelos aprendam continuamente com novos dados sem a necessidade de re-treinamento completo. Outra técnica é o uso de transfer learning, onde um modelo pré-treinado é ajustado para uma nova tarefa com um conjunto de dados menor. Essas técnicas ajudam a otimizar o processo de renovação, tornando-o mais eficiente e menos custoso.
Impacto da renovação na performance
A renovação impacta diretamente a performance dos sistemas de IA e ML. Modelos que são regularmente renovados tendem a apresentar maior precisão e relevância nas suas previsões. Isso é especialmente importante em setores como finanças, saúde e marketing, onde decisões baseadas em dados precisam ser precisas e oportunas. A falta de renovação pode resultar em decisões erradas e, consequentemente, em perdas financeiras ou danos à reputação.
Exemplos de renovação em prática
Um exemplo prático de renovação pode ser observado em sistemas de recomendação, como os utilizados por plataformas de streaming. Esses sistemas precisam ser constantemente renovados com novos dados de usuários para oferecer recomendações precisas e personalizadas. Outro exemplo é o uso de modelos de previsão de demanda em varejo, que precisam ser atualizados regularmente para refletir as mudanças nas preferências dos consumidores e nas condições de mercado.
Futuro da renovação em IA e ML
O futuro da renovação em IA e ML promete ser ainda mais dinâmico. Com o avanço das tecnologias de automação e a crescente disponibilidade de dados, espera-se que os processos de renovação se tornem mais ágeis e eficientes. Além disso, a integração de técnicas de IA explicativa pode ajudar a entender melhor como e por que a renovação é necessária, permitindo que as organizações tomem decisões mais informadas sobre quando e como renovar seus modelos e dados.
